My surgeon is doing a wrist arthroscopy with a TFCC repair. While in the wrist he finds osteonecrosis of the "proximal and dorsal aspect of the lunate". He does a "partial excision to reach healthier more stable edges of the bone and cartilage. He states about 10-20% of the proximal and dorsal aspect of the lunate was removed by arthroscopic patrial lunate excision." He wants to bill 25210 for this which or course is not correct since that is an open procedure.

My question is, is this partial lunate excision part of the code, 29846 for the TFCC debridement and repair, or will I need to use an unlisted code compared to 25210?
